All applicants who apply online by January 1 and have completed the admission process are automatically considered for La Follette fellowships. La Follette fellowships are awarded based on merit and typically offer a stipend, in-state tuition and health insurance.
All La Follette students can apply for financial assistance to offset costs of their summer internship. The summer internship stipend process is handled separately during the year through the Career Development Office.
Applicants who meet the eligibility requirements for the university Advanced Opportunity Fellowships will automatically be considered for support.
